PowerPoint for Mac will roll out the “Explain this presentation” skill in September 2026, providing users with an impartial summary of slides, charts, notes, and key data to help understand presentations faster. No action is required, but a Copilot license is needed.
Rolling out in Frontier, this skill reads the whole deck: slides, charts, tables and speaker notes, and hands back an impartial guide: the gist, the ask, the key takeaways, key numbers and open questions.
This experience can help users review and understand presentations more efficiently and identify information that may require further attention.

After this change, users can access a personalized reading guide for a presentation. The guide provides an impartial summary of the presentation and highlights:
- The presentation’s main idea
- Key takeaways
- Important numbers
- Relevant visuals
- Speaker notes
- Open questions
This change is intended to help users understand presentation content more quickly.
Action required / Recommendations
No action is required.
A Copilot license is required.
You may want to inform your users about this new experience and update internal training or support documentation as appropriate.
